The Small Strings is a band comprising numerous ukulele players, a rhythm section of bass and cajon, and a number of vocalists. The band, led by Dave Stewart, meets weekly in Reading, learning new playing skills, fine-tuning its repertoire, and, most of all, having a ton of fun.

The Burghfield Santas are a group of local residents that create fun events for the residents of Burghfield and the surrounding area to raise money for local charities.
It all started with Santa Cruise 16 years ago when a group of mates went out for a few drinks after making and wrapping many presents. We wore our red suits and raised a little money for the Thames Valley Air Ambulance.
We did this again and again many times and somewhere along the way we realised that charity fundraising is not just for Christmas but Easter too. The Bunny Hop was born, closely followed by Burghfest which satisfied our need for good music, good company & good local beer.
The next challenge was to return racing to the historical home of the Auclum Hill Climb, so in 2017 we launched the annual Box Kart Bash.
2018, saw the launch of The Bulging Sack, our very own Pop Up Pub. This came to its own in 2020 when due to the coronavirus our major events were canceled. It opened Friday and Saturday evenings in the summer and raised almost £10,000 for Thames Valley Air Ambulance as well as providing a chance for the community to get together.
In 2021, coronavirus was still impacting our event schedule but we were able to open The Bulging Sack, in the summer and Burghfest returned bigger and better than before.
Over the years, with your help, we have raised over £250,000 for the Thames Valley Air Ambulance and other local charities

The inaugural “Burghfest” was attended by over 2,000 people who manged to consume 3,800 pints of beer and 1,200 pints of cider but more importantly raised £11,500 for the Thames Valley Air Ambulance. Read More…
